A standard license is strictly tied to a single Platform ID (one computer). If you need to use it on another PC, you must purchase a second license.
Because the license is account-based, sharing your login details is a violation of the Terms of Service. If the system detects multiple logins from different locations, your account can be suspended or banned. zmodeler3 license
ZModeler3 uses a subscription-based licensing model that requires periodic validation to maintain full software functionality.

The license is non-transferable . If you change your motherboard or CPU, the Platform ID changes, and your license will not work. You would need to contact support (which may require a small fee for HWID reset) or buy a new license.
Once you have an active paid license, you have full commercial rights to sell or distribute the 3D models you create.
Users can purchase 90-day, 360-day, or 720-day licenses. A 720-day license offers the best value, bringing the effective price down to approximately $3.50 per month .
